Madonna and Child with the Infant Saint John the Baptist (painting (visual work); Giovanni Lanfranco (Italian, 1582 - 1647); about 1630 - 1632; J. Paul Getty Museum at the Getty Center (Los Angeles, Los A...; 84.PA.683) | |
Note: This painting's small scale and sensitive, poetic intimacy contrast with Giovanni Lanfranco's more usual grand, illusionistic decorations. The painting's frame, a type that was often used in the Barberini Palace in Rome, hints at the picture's previous location. Lanfranco may have painted it for a private chapel owned by the Barberini, Pope Urban VIII's family and leading patrons of Baroque art in Rome in the 1600s. | |
